GTK+2.24.8Win32安装包

Windows 下搞 GUI 开发,还在用 Python 2.7 的你,会遇到 GTK+ 3 不兼容的问题。GTK+ 2.24.8这个老牌版本就比较稳,配合 PyGTK 用着挺顺,尤其适合老项目维护或者对轻量界面有要求的工具型应用。

gtk+-bundle_2.24.8-20111122_win32是打包好的安装包,直接解压就能用。目录结构也清晰,有bin放可执行文件,lib装的是动态库,include给你引用头文件。要写点 C 语言扩展或者调 GTK 底层 API,也都齐活了。

重点是它对 Python 2.7 环境友好,用 PyGTK 或者老版本PyGObject都不成问题。你只要把bin加到环境变量里,基本就能跑了。顺手还能看看README.txt,里面有些小细节比如路径配置啥的。

整个包还带src源码目录,想研究 GTK 底层实现的话挺方便,哪怕不改代码,看看也能多了解点 GTK 事件机制、信号之类的。加上share里还有主题图标字体啥的,UI 也能稍微折腾一下。

如果你现在还在维护 Python 2.7 的 GUI 工具,或者就是图个轻巧,懒得折腾 GTK+ 3 的依赖地狱,这个包确实挺省心。装完直接用,响应也快,适合写点快速原型、内部工具那种。

对 GTK+感兴趣的你,可以去看看这些资料:

如果你还在用 Python 2.7 搞桌面应用,又不想被 GTK+ 3 整崩溃,可以直接用这个包试试,省时省力还稳定。

8-20111122_win32
gtk+-bundle_2.24.8-20111122_win32 预估大小:2000个文件
file
COPYING-MPL-1.1 25KB
file
COPYING-LGPL-2.1 26KB
file
glib-gettextize.1 2KB
file
gobject-query.1 2KB
file
fc-list.1 2KB
file
gdk-pixbuf-csource.1 4KB
file
fc-match.1 2KB
file
glib-compile-schemas.1 3KB
file
gdk-pixbuf-query-loaders.1 3KB
file
gsettings.1 4KB
file
glib-genmarshal.1 7KB
file
ngettext.1 2KB
file
gettext.1 2KB
file
gdbus.1 8KB
file
pkg-config.1 17KB
file
glib-mkenums.1 7KB
file
pango-view.1 3KB
file
fc-cache.1 2KB
file
pango-querymodules.1 2KB
file
xmlwf.1 8KB
zip 文件大小:23.62MB